My rose gold ankle pants are actually coated pixie pants from Old Navy. Coated pants are the latest trend in pants right now.  These pants are rose gold metallic, and they shimmer and shine. They look so pretty with the cream sweatshirt and black accessories. To make them work for maternity wear, I just added a  belly band. If you’re unfamiliar with what a belly band is, it’s a stretchy band of fabric that stretches over the top part of your pants to hold them up when they won’t zip.

Now on to three New Year’s resolutions you SHOULD make this year.

#1 NEW YEAR’S RESOLUTION TO MAKE THIS YEAR: Be More Engaged

Ok, this one is a biggie for me. It’s no secret that I’m always on the go, and I’m always plugged in.  It’s not unusual for me to be responding to emails when we’re having family time, or posting to social while we’re at dinner. This year, however, I’m making a concerted effort to be more engaged with my family. That means I’m going to try my best to put my phone down while we’re at dinner and when we’re having family time.

#2 NEW YEAR’S RESOLUTION TO MAKE THIS YEAR: Cut Back on Procrastinating

Y’all, I procrastinate about everything. But with a new baby on the way, I want to get it together for once.  Therefore, my second New Year’s Resolution is to cut back on procrastinating. I mean, let’s be real–I’m not going to completely stop procrastinating. Procrastinating is part of who I am.  But I can aim to cut back on procrastinating. While I will probably continue to procrastinate on the small things, I need to give myself more time to accomplish bigger projects.

#3 NEW YEAR’S RESOLUTION TO MAKE THIS YEAR: Say Yes to Things Outside of Your Comfort Zone

It’s difficult to step outside your comfort zone.  It’s scary to take risks and try new things. My third New Year’s Resolution is to say yes to something outside of my comfort zone. Sometimes you have to say yes to something scary, or something intimidating, to see movement in your life. If you don’t step outside of your comfort zone zone, though, you’ll never grow as a person or reach your full potential. I’m not saying to do something crazy–I’m just encouraging you to look at opportunities in a new light and think about saying yes to something  that you’d otherwise say no.
